sigrennesmetropole / geor_urbanisme_mapstore

GNU General Public License v3.0
2 stars 5 forks source link

Urbanisme changes related to MapStore layout update #50

Closed alexander-fedorenko closed 2 years ago

alexander-fedorenko commented 2 years ago

Description

This PR applies several changes and improvements to the urbanisme extension to make it compatible with the updated MapStore layout (https://github.com/geosolutions-it/MapStore2/issues/8086)

  1. Urbanisme added to the sidebar menu container.
  2. Toolbar position will be changed to vertical if right panel is open & toolbar can fit to the available height (so that it won't overlap map toolbar).

Please check if the PR fulfills these requirements

What kind of change does this PR introduce? (check one with "x", remove the others)

Issue

What is the current behavior? Urbanisme extension toolbar is always positioned horizontally, which might be a problem on small screens.

What is the new behavior? Toolbar will adjust it's positioning depending on available height & right panel appearance. Urbanisme tool will be available in sidebar menu.

Breaking change

Does this PR introduce a breaking change? (check one with "x", remove the other)

Other useful information